Christmas observances in Christianity refer to the annual celebration of the birth of Jesus Christ on December 25th.

Key Features

  • Attending church services
  • Decorating homes and churches with festive decorations
  • Exchanging gifts with loved ones
  • Participating in Christmas carol singing
  • Preparation of special meals and feasting
